The Long Journey Tumbler

Details: This object is hand built, hand painted and one of a kind. Signed by the artist.

Ingredients & Materials: Porcelain with gold lustre.

Measurements: This item measures ~3" in diameter and 3" tall;.

Care & Use: Hand wash with soft cloth or sponge with non-abrasive cleaner. Food-safe.

Sold individually.

Item Details

Available online and in store in One Calls The Tune, The Other Pays the Piper, a gallery showcase of rare and unusual functional ceramics by Suzanne Sullivan and Maggie Boyd — two friends channeling the spirit of debauchery in “A Cook’s Tale” from Chaucer’s Canterbury Tales — that depict medieval motifs and inspire raucous gatherings, presented by Mociun.
